Nforce 4 Pic

Published by Newsfactory 0

Fido over at The Inquirer has snagged a picture of MSI's Nforce 4 motherboard!

You will notice that board has only one chip covered with active cooler, PCIe 16X slot and two PCIe 1X slots, four PCI slots where one is possibly 266 MB/s fast, four memory slots, marvels eight SATA ports four of them controlled or helped by silicon image chip. The board still has two IDE channels and a floppy connector. A Via chip in front of PCIe 16X slot was one of the things that created a nice smile on my face. What an irony.

Nvidia Geforce 6200 Information And Pictures

Published by [NT] 2

New GeForce 6200 Graphics Processor First to Deliver DirectX 9.0 Shader Model 3.0, NVIDIA UltraShadow II Technology, and High Definition Video Playback at Value Prices Here are the specs: GPU: NV43 Architecture: - 4 pipelines with 3 vertex units core: 300Mhz memory: 275 (550) 128 bit DDR1 memory (128 MB or 256MB) Shader Model 3 Ultrashadow II video enhancements 100% PCIe compliant no SLI capability Price: $129 for 128MB version - $149 for 256MB version GeForce 6200 GPUs are shipping now and GeForce 6200-based graphics boards will be available from leading add-in card manufacturers in November. Creative Debuts The PCMCIA Sound Blaster Audigy 2 ZS Notebook

Published by Newsfactory 0

Creative has launched the first Sound Blaster card in a PCMCIA format for notebooks. It features EAX 4.0 ADVANCED HD, Dolby Digital EX and DTS-ES built-in decoding, ASIO 2.0 recording, 7.1 surround sound, and DVD-Audio 24-bit/192kHz playback. Check it out here.

Eight Power Supplies Compared @ TechReport

Published by Newsfactory 0

I'VE Extolled the virtues of quality power supplies so many times that saying they're the most often overlooked PC component feels like a cliche. But it's true. In my experience, poor quality generic-brand power supplies are often the root of PC stability problems. Also, as new processors and graphics cards demand more power than ever before, quality power supplies are becoming more important.
